Understand the .NET Full-Stack Intern Role
Before venturing into the hiring process, it’s pivotal to grasp the essence of a .NET full-stack intern’s role in your organization. This understanding helps set clear expectations for potential candidates:
- Front-End Development: Proficiency in HTML, CSS, JavaScript, and frameworks such as Angular or React is essential.
- Back-End Development: Knowledge of C# and ASP.NET MVC/Core is critical.
- Database Management: Experience with databases such as SQL Server or PostgreSQL is expected.
- API Development: Building and consuming RESTful services is a common requirement.
- Problem Solving: Strong analytical skills to troubleshoot and solve issues.
- Soft Skills: Communication, teamwork, and the ability to adapt to new tools and technologies quickly.
Having a thorough understanding of these requirements allows you to tailor your search process and identify candidates who fit your organizational needs.
Optimize Job Descriptions
A well-crafted job description is your starting point in attracting potential candidates. This step cannot be emphasized enough. Here are some tips on how to optimize job descriptions for .NET full-stack interns:
- Highlight Key Skills: Clearly state the technical and soft skills required for the role. Consider including desired frameworks and languages.
- Define Responsibilities: Explicitly outline the intern’s expected duties and tasks.
- Advocate for Your Company Culture: Describe your company's work environment and culture to attract candidates whose values align with yours.
- Incorporate SEO: Use specific keywords that potential candidates might search for. Phrases like 'Dot NET intern,' '.NET full-stack trainee', or '.NET development internship’ can enhance visibility.
- Set Clear Application Instructions: Make the application process straightforward and user-friendly.
Leverage Specialized Job Portals and Platforms
Identifying the right platforms to post your job vacancy can dramatically impact the range and quality of applicants. Here’s where you might consider advertising:
- LinkedIn: A professional network rich with tech talent, LinkedIn is an excellent platform for both posting jobs and connecting with potential candidates.
- GitHub Job Board: Developers routinely use GitHub, making it an ideal place to attract technically apt candidates.
- Tech-Specific Job Portals: Websites like Stack Overflow Jobs and Indeed Tech focus on technological job roles.
- University Portals: Collaborate with university career services centers to access a talent pool of soon-to-be graduates eager for hands-on experience.
Networking and Referrals
Word-of-mouth and networking remain potent tools in recruitment. Encourage your current employees to refer potential candidates. They can reach out to acquaintances, increasing the chances of finding a reliable intern.
- Referral Bonuses: Offer incentives for successful referrals to motivate employees to recommend quality candidates.
- Attend Networking Events: Participate in tech meetups, hackathons, and university career fairs to meet talent face-to-face.
Building relationships within the tech community can provide ongoing access to a network of budding developers ready to commence their careers.
Conduct Efficient and Comprehensive Interviews
The interview process is crucial in identifying candidates who meet your criteria. Ensure your interview strategy is structured and comprehensive:
- Technical Assessments: Include coding challenges or practical tests to objectively evaluate technical skills.
- Cultural Fit Interviews: Use behavioral interviews to gauge whether the intern’s personality aligns with your company culture.
- Feedback Sessions: Allow for immediate feedback to eliminate unsuitable candidates early.
These methods ensure every candidate meets the minimum qualifications, while also providing insights into their potential to contribute positively to your organization.
Lean on Technology for Streamlining Processes
Embrace technology to streamline your hiring process effectively. Here’s how technology can assist in finding top .NET full-stack interns:
- Applicant Tracking Systems (ATS): Use ATS to manage applications, streamline resume sorting, and simplify the shortlisting process.
- Online Coding Platforms: Platforms like HackerRank or Codility offer online assessments to test coding skills prior to interviews.
- Automating Communication: Use automated emails to keep candidates informed about their application status and next steps, enhancing the candidate experience.
